Project summary

Following the successful development of VPs in BM5 Years 1 and 2, the next phase of the Virtual Patients project is currently being rolled out for BM5 Clinical Years. VPs in Years 1 and 2 guide students through the clinical process while helping them learn basic science in a clinical context. Clinical Year Virtual Patients will have a different focus.
BM5 students in their clinical years undertake numerous clinical attachments at hospitals or GP surgeries developing their clinical, decision making and patient management skills and getting ready to practice. To support their learning, this project aims to develop Virtual Patients, which students can use as learning and revision tools consolidating key clinical skills, history taking, physical examination, investigation, differential diagnosis, clinical reasoning and decision making (and patient management for final year).
